- 1 ½ cups grated zucchini - 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our - 1 cup granulated sugar - ½ cup packed brown sugar - 1 teaspoon baking soda - ½ teaspoon baking powder - 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on - 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g - ½ teaspoon salt - 2 large eggs, at room temperature - ½ cup vegetable oil - 1 teaspoon vanilla extract - ½ cup chopped walnuts or pecans (optional) - 2 tablespoons granulated sugar (for topping) - 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on (for topping) You need fresh ingredients for the best flavor. Zucchini adds moisture to the bread. I like using medium-sized zucchini, about one will do. Make sure to grate it well. Use good-quality flour to give the bread a nice rise. The sugars create a sweet balance. Granulated and brown sugar work great together. Baking soda and baking powder help the bread rise. Spices like cinnamon and nutmeg add warmth. Don’t skip the salt; it enhances all the flavors. Room temperature eggs mix better and help with rising. Vegetable oil keeps the bread moist. Vanilla extract adds a lovely depth. If you want a crunch, add walnuts or pecans. The topping of sugar and cinnamon gives a sweet crust. You can find the Full Recipe for step-by-step guidance. Get ready to bake! -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). - Prepare the loaf pan by greasing it or lining it with parchment paper. This helps with easy removal later. - Grate 1 medium zucchini until you have about 1 ½ cups. - Place the grated zucchini in a clean kitchen towel. - Wring it out to remove excess moisture. Set it aside to dry. - In a large bowl, combine these dry ingredients: - 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our - 1 cup granulated sugar - ½ cup packed brown sugar - 1 teaspoon baking soda - ½ teaspoon baking powder - 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on - 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g - ½ teaspoon salt - Whisk everything together until well mixed. This ensures no lumps remain. - In another bowl, crack 2 large eggs and beat them lightly. - Add ½ cup vegetable oil and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ract to the eggs. - Mix until everything is well blended. - Pour the egg mixture into the dry ingredients. - Stir gently with a spatula until just combined. - A few lumps are okay; do not over-mix. - Fold in the drained zucchini and ½ cup chopped walnuts or pecans if you choose to use them. - Transfer the batter into the prepared loaf pan. - Smooth the top with a spatula. - In a small bowl, mix 2 tablespoons of granulated sugar with 1 teaspoon of cinnamon for the topping. - Evenly sprinkle this mixture over the batter. - Bake in the preheated oven for 60-65 minutes. - The bread is done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s. - Let the bread cool in the pan for about 10 minutes. - Carefully remove it from the pan and cool completely on a wire rack. - 1 cup unsalted butter - 2 cups granulated sugar - 4 large eggs - 1 teaspoon vanilla extract - 1 cup all-purpose flour - 1 cup unsweetened cocoa powder - 1/2 teaspoon salt - 16 oz cream cheese, softened to room temperature - 1 cup granulated sugar - 3 large eggs - 1 teaspoon vanilla extract - 1/4 cup sour cream - 1/4 cup heavy cream - 1 cup granulated sugar - 6 tablespoons unsalted butter, cut into pieces - 1/2 cup heavy cream, at room temperature - A pinch of salt The brownie base gives this dessert its rich, chocolate flavor. The cream cheese layer adds a creamy texture. The caramel sauce is the sweet finish that ties everything together. You need to measure your ingredients carefully. Start with the brownie base. Melt the butter in a pan. Mix in sugar and eggs. Then add the vanilla, flour, cocoa, and salt. The batter should be thick and smooth. Next, the cheesecake layer needs cream cheese. Make sure it’s soft to mix well. Add sugar and eggs, then fold in sour cream and heavy cream. This will make the cheesecake rich and creamy. For the caramel sauce, heat sugar in a pan until it melts. Stir in butter and cream. Be careful, as it will bubble. A pinch of salt enhances the flavor. Check out the Full Recipe for a complete guide on how to bring these ingredients together into a delicious dessert. 1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). 2. Grease a 9-inch springform pan well. You can also use parchment paper for easy removal. 3. In a medium saucepan, melt 1 cup of unsalted butter over low heat. 4. Once melted, mix in 2 cups of granulated sugar until well blended. 5. Add 4 large eggs one at a time, mixing until smooth each time. 6. Stir in 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. 7. Gradually add 1 cup of all-purpose flour, 1 cup of unsweetened cocoa powder, and 1/2 teaspoon of salt. Mix just until combined. 8. Pour the batter into the prepared pan, smoothing it out evenly. 9. Bake for 20-25 minutes. A toothpick should come out with a few moist crumbs. 10. Let the brownie layer cool completely in the pan. 1. In a large mixing bowl, beat 16 oz of softened cream cheese with 1 cup of sugar until smooth. 2. Add 3 large eggs one at a time, mixing well after each. 3. Fold in 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ract, 1/4 cup of sour cream, and 1/4 cup of heavy cream. Mix until silky. 1. Pour the cheesecake batter over the cooled brownie base. 2. Use a spatula to smooth the top. 3. Lower the oven temperature to 325°F (160°C). 4. Bake for 50-60 minutes. The edges should set, but the center can jiggle. 5. Turn off the oven and crack the door open. Let the cheesecake cool there for an hour. 1. In a medium saucepan, add 1 cup of granulated sugar over medium heat. 2. Allow it to melt until it turns an amber color. Swirl the pan gently. 3. Once melted, remove from heat and quickly whisk in 6 tablespoons of unsalted butter. 4. Carefully add 1/2 cup of heavy cream. It will bubble up, so be cautious. 5. Mix in a pinch of salt and set the caramel sauce aside to cool. 1. Once the cheesecake cools to room temperature, pour the caramel sauce over the top. 2. Spread it evenly with a spatula. 3.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ight. 4. To serve, release the sides of the springform pan and remove it. 5. Slice the cheesecake and drizzle with any leftover caramel if you like. You can dive deeper into this delightful dessert by checking the Full Recipe. To make the perfect brownie base, avoid overmixing the batter. Mixing too much can lead to a cake-like texture. Stir just until the flour disappears. Keep an eye on baking times, as they can vary. Check them at 20 minutes for moist, fudgy brownies. A toothpick should come out with a few moist crumbs, not wet batter. For extra fudginess, use a higher cocoa powder ratio and add an extra egg yolk. Use room temperature ingredients for the cheesecake layer. This helps achieve a smooth texture. Cold cream cheese can form lumps that are hard to mix out. To prevent cracks, bake the cheesecake in a water bath. This creates a gentle heat that reduces temperature changes. After baking, let the cheesecake cool gradually in the oven. Cracking often happens with sudden temperature shifts. Making caramel can be tricky. A common issue is sugar crystallizing if stirred too soon. Melt the sugar undisturbed until it turns amber. If it gets too sweet, add a pinch of salt for balance. If your caramel is too thick, you can adjust it. Adding a splash of water or cream helps achieve the right pourable consistency. For serving, you can microwave any leftover caramel. To make Heavenly Vanilla Mousse, you need these key ingredients: - 2 cups heavy whipping cream - 1 cup sweetened condensed milk - 2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ract - 1 teaspoon unflavored gelatin powder - 3 tablespoons cold water - 1/4 cup powdered sugar - A pinch of salt These ingredients create a rich and creamy dessert. Each one plays a role. The heavy cream gives the mousse its lightness. The sweetened condensed milk adds sweetness and creaminess. Vanilla extract gives a warm flavor. Gelatin helps the mousse set properly. You can make your mousse even more special with these garnishes: - Fresh berries (like strawberries, blueberries, or raspberries) - Fresh mint leaves These garnishes add color and freshness to the dessert. They also enhance the overall taste, making the mousse more appealing. If you need to make changes, here are some ideas: - Use coconut cream instead of heavy cream for a dairy-free option. - Replace sweetened condensed milk with coconut milk for a lighter taste. - If you want a different flavor, try almond or hazelnut extract instead of vanilla. These substitutions allow you to customize the mousse to fit your needs and preferences. You can still enjoy a delicious dessert even if you don't have all the original ingredients. For the full recipe, check out the Heavenly Vanilla Mousse Dessert. To bloom the gelatin, start by measuring one teaspoon of unflavored gelatin powder. Place it in a small bowl. Next, add three tablespoons of cold water to the bowl. Let it sit for about five minutes. During this time, the gelatin will absorb the water and swell. After five minutes, gently heat the bowl in a small saucepan over low heat. Stir it occasionally until the gelatin completely dissolves. Be careful not to boil it. Once dissolved, remove it from the heat and let it cool slightly. Next, take two cups of heavy whipping cream and pour it into a large mixing bowl. Add a quarter cup of powdered sugar to the cream. Using an electric mixer, beat the mixture on medium speed. Keep mixing until soft peaks form. This means the cream should hold a shape but still be soft. Make sure not to overbeat, or it will turn grainy and lose its fluffy texture. The key is to stop when it looks light and airy. Now, it’s time to combine everything. Gently fold in one cup of sweetened condensed milk and two teaspoons of pure vanilla extract into the whipped cream. Use a spatula and be careful not to deflate the cream. Next, take the cooled gelatin and slowly fold it into the creamy mixture. Mix gently to keep the mousse airy. Once everything is well combined, spoon or pour the mixture into individual serving cups. Cover them with plastic wrap or lids. Place them in the fridge for at least two hours to set. When ready to serve, top each mousse with fresh berries and mint leaves for a lovely touch. To whip cream well, start with cold cream. Cold cream whips better and faster. Use a mixing bowl that is also cold. You can chill it in the fridge or freezer for a bit. This helps keep the cream cold while whipping. - Use an electric mixer for faster results. - Beat the cream on medium speed. - Stop when you see soft peaks. Soft peaks mean the cream is fluffy, not too stiff. To get the lightest texture in your mousse, fold gently. Folding means mixing without beating. When you add the sweetened condensed milk and vanilla, use a spatula. - Add the dissolved gelatin last to keep air in the mix. - Mix slowly and carefully to avoid losing air. If you mix too hard, the mousse can become heavy. One mistake is overbeating the cream. If you beat it too long, it can turn into butter. Another mistake is not letting the gelatin cool enough. Hot gelatin can melt the cream. - Always bloom your gelatin first, then dissolve it. - Don’t skip chilling the mousse after mixing. It helps it set and taste better. - Use fresh berries for garnish, but don’t add them too early. They can make the mousse soggy if they sit too long. The best cream for mousse is heavy whipping cream. It whips up well and creates a light texture. Look for cream with at least 36% fat. This high fat content helps the mousse hold its shape. Using lighter cream may lead to a runny dessert. Make sure the cream is cold for the best results. Yes, you can make this mousse ahead of time! It stays fresh in the fridge for up to three days. Just cover the cups with plastic wrap. This makes it a great choice for parties or busy days. Prepare it the day before and let it set. Your guests will love it when you serve it. To make this dessert dairy-free, use coconut cream instead of heavy whipping cream. Chill a can of full-fat coconut milk overnight. Scoop out the solid cream and whip it like regular cream. Use a dairy-free sweetened condensed milk alternative for the other ingredients. This swap keeps the creamy texture and taste. Enjoy a delightful dessert that fits your needs!
